Planning Permission in Pembrokeshire: 85.1% Approval Rate

Pembrokeshire Council approves 85.1% of planning applications, based on 29,449 real decisions analysed from the council’s public planning portal. The national average across all councils tracked by PlanningLens is 88.6%. Pembrokeshire sits 3.5 percentage points below the national average.

29,449 decisions analysed·Updated August 2026·Every result links to the original council record

According to PlanningLens analysis of 905 decided applications, Pembrokeshire Council approved 79.4% of planning applications in 2025. Across 29,449 decisions analysed since January 2020, the overall approval rate in Pembrokeshire is 85.1%; the national average across UK councils tracked by PlanningLens is 88.6%.

Planning Approval Rates by Ward in Pembrokeshire

Ward-level data reveals where planning applications are most and least likely to succeed. Officers, local policies, and neighbourhood character all play a role.

Ward variation in Pembrokeshire: Haverfordwest: Portfield has the highest approval rate at 93.4%, while Carew And Jeffreyston sits at 64.7%. That 28.7 percentage point gap matters, where your property sits can shift your odds significantly.

About Pembrokeshire Planning Data: This analysis draws on 29,449 planning decisions published by Pembrokeshire council. Every application is classified as approved or refused based on the council's own decision wording. Withdrawn applications and procedural outcomes are excluded.
